Dr. George Edward "Mason" Porta, 28 of Lancaster, Pennsylvania, loving son, brother, uncle, and grandson, passed away unexpectedly on June 15, 2025.  Born in Louisville, Kentucky, he was the son of Michael Porta and Kimberly Bagley.

Having earned his Doctor of Pharmacy degree from University of Kentucky, he most recently worked at CVS Pharmacy in Lancaster. He had also been offered and accepted a position as a clinical pharmacist at Penn Med Rehabilitation Hospital, where he was hoping to pursue research.

Mason was a prolific musician/songwriter and loved camping and hiking. A tremendous humanitarian, he spent time as a youth, volunteering with Hand in Hand Ministries in communities to repair and build housing. As a student at UK, he was heavily involved in Big Blue Kitchen, a program to help provide for students with food needs.

In addition to his mother and father, Mason is survived by siblings, Ahren Porta, Nick Porta, Levi Porta, and Gracie Evans; as well as grandparents, Larry and Rita Dennison, and Mary Ann Porta. He was predeceased by his grandfather, Jim Porta.
